What are the responsibilities and job description for the Vice President of Sales position at Watershield Industries?
Primary Objectives and Responsibilities
- Own and drive consolidated revenue growth, gross margin expansion, and sales effectiveness across all business units.
- Develop and execute a comprehensive commercial strategy, including market segmentation, channel strategy (direct vs. dealer/distributor/rep), pricing architecture, and go-to-market execution.
- Partner with executive leadership and private equity stakeholders to present performance, forecasts, and key initiatives at the board level.
- Establish and standardize sales processes, KPIs, forecasting methodologies, and CRM utilization across the organization.
- Evaluate and optimize pricing strategies, discount frameworks, and commission structures to align incentives with profitability and growth objectives.
- Lead sales talent strategy, including recruiting, development, performance management, and succession planning across operating companies.
- Drive accountability through consistent cadence of performance reviews, pipeline management, and KPI tracking.
- Manage Marketing efforts across all brands of Watershield Industries.
- Collaborate cross-functionally with operations and finance, and marketing to improve alignment, increase conversion rates, and enhance customer experience.
- Identify and pursue new market opportunities, including expansion into new geographies, customer segments, and product adjacencies.
- Support M&A initiatives, including commercial due diligence, integration planning, and post-acquisition sales optimization.
- Maintain strong relationships with key customers, vendors, and strategic partners to enhance market position and drive growth.
Qualifications
- 10 years of progressive sales leadership experience, including multi-entity or multi-division responsibility.
- Proven experience in manufacturing and distribution environments, including both direct sales and dealer/distributor networks.
- Demonstrated success managing complex sales organizations with varied territories, exclusivity structures, and product lines.
- Background of leading experienced sales personnel to individual and corporate success.
- Experience interacting with executive leadership, boards of directors, and/or private equity investors.
- Strong track record of achieving revenue targets while improving gross margins and operational efficiency.
- Bachelor’s degree required, MBA or advanced degree preferred.
- Willingness to travel up to ~40%.
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
- Deep understanding of market segmentation, customer buying behavior, and competitive positioning.
- Expertise in pricing strategy, margin management, and sales incentive design (commission structures, bonus plans, etc.).
- Strong financial acumen, with the ability to interpret and communicate performance metrics, forecasts, and ROI-driven decisions.
- Experience building and scaling CRM-driven sales organizations (e.g., pipeline discipline, weighted forecasting, KPI dashboards).
- Ability to operate effectively across multiple business models, including niche manufacturing, national distribution, and territory-based sales structures.
